Interpretation:

The structure of the molecule of type ML4 that has four single bonds and no lone pairs has to be determined.

Concept Introduction:

VSEPR or valence shell electron pair repulsion theory predicts the shape of the molecules with the use of arrangement of electrons around the central metal atom. Its postulates are as follows:

1. The shape of the molecules is governed by the repulsion between electron pairs situated in the outermost or valence shell of the atoms.

2. A distortion is observed in the shape of the molecules if lone pairs are present in it. These are the electron pairs that do not participate in the chemical bonding between the atoms. The electron pairs that take part in bond formation are known as bond pairs.

3. The order of repulsion of electron pairs is as follows:

  lplp repulsion>lpbp repulsion >bpbp repulsion

4. Multiple bonds create more repulsion as compared to single bonds.

5. The following table shows the various molecular shapes that match to different number of electron pairs:

Number ofelectron groupsNumber of lone pairsMolecular geometry20Linear30Trigonal planar31Bent40Tetrahedral41Trigonal pyramid42Bent50Trigonal bipyramidal51Seesaw52Tstructure53Linear60Octahedral61Square pyramidal62Square planar
